Bill of Materials (BOM): The Foundation of Production
The Bill of Materials defines everything required to produce a product.
In Odoo, BOMs can include:
- Raw materials and components
- Subassemblies and multi-level structures
- Manufacturing operations and routing steps
- Work center instructions
- Alternative components
This structure allows production planners to clearly understand what must be built, what must be purchased, and what must be assembled internally.
More importantly, it removes uncertainty.
Production teams always work from one reliable BOM structure, reducing mistakes and accelerating execution.

Product Lifecycle Management (PLM): Control Change Without Chaos
Engineering change is unavoidable.
Products evolve due to:
- Quality improvements
- Supplier changes
- Cost optimisation
- Regulatory requirements
- Customer feedback
The challenge is not change itself—the challenge is managing change safely.
Odoo PLM introduces structured change control through:
- Engineering Change Orders (ECO)
- Revision tracking
- Approval workflows
- Document version management
- Collaboration between engineering and production
Every change moves through a clear review and approval process.
This prevents unverified changes from reaching the shop floor.
Revision Management That Prevents Production Errors
One of the most common manufacturing risks is using the wrong product revision.
Odoo eliminates this risk through controlled revision management.
When a design change occurs:
- A new revision is created
- Previous versions remain traceable
- Production orders automatically reference the correct revision
- Documentation stays aligned with the BOM
This protects both quality and accountability.
Supervisors know exactly which revision was used in every production run.
Engineering Change Orders (ECO)
Engineering Change Orders provide a formal way to evaluate and implement product modifications.
In Odoo, ECO workflows can include:
- Design review
- Cost impact analysis
- Quality validation
- Management approval
- Controlled deployment to production
This structured process ensures that decisions are deliberate—not reactive.
It replaces informal emails and verbal instructions with a traceable decision record.

FAQs - Odoo BOM & PLM for Manufacturing
Q1: What is the difference between BOM and PLM?
BOM defines the product structure and materials, while PLM manages design changes, revisions, and engineering workflows.
Q2: Can Odoo support multi-level BOM structures?
Yes. Odoo supports complex multi-level assemblies and subassemblies.
Q3: How does Odoo manage product revisions?
Each change creates a new revision with full traceability and version history.
Q4: What is an Engineering Change Order (ECO)?
An ECO is a structured workflow used to review, approve, and implement product changes.
Q5: Do engineering changes affect production planning automatically?
Yes. Approved revisions can automatically update production and procurement processes.
